Output ec20a60c2d0ce21dad5c123264e5e42c218193b3799221b34fc514c8e504dfb0:134

value
41489
script pubkey
OP_0 OP_PUSHBYTES_20 cdcb34789ee06bb49075534fb1f6e1c97ea37456
address
bc1qeh9ng7y7up4mfyr42d8mrahpe9l2xazkvvfedg
transaction
ec20a60c2d0ce21dad5c123264e5e42c218193b3799221b34fc514c8e504dfb0
spent
true